Why invest?

 

Truly active stock picking 

  • Research-intensive – the team focuses on bottom-up analysis to identify mispriced companies that can grow profitably and have a competitive edge over their peers. They also look at catalysts that may influence a company’s stock. 
  • Diversified – each investment must fit into one of three categories (see below), allowing the Sub-Fund to seek better diversification and navigate through bull and bear markets. 
  • High conviction – a highly active portfolio targeting 30 to 40 stocks, typically with a mid to large cap bias. The team favours depth over breadth.

A balanced allocation across three distinct categories6

 

1. Quality

Investable universe: 60-70 stocks 25-40% of the portfolio

High quality companies with a dom-inant competitive position and high barriers to entry

 

2. Growth

Investable universe: 80-90 stocks 25-40% of the portfolio

High growth companies with above-average revenue growth.

 

3. Events

Investable universe: c.150 stocks 25-40% of the portfolio

Candidates for takeovers, break-ups and other corporate events.

Examples

 

 

 

 

A global chemicals supplier proved its pricing power in an oligopoly market. It grew 5% across the cycle, with a cash-generative business model.

 

Despite the challenging consumer environment, a UK discount retailer gained market share through a focused product range and direct sourcing model.

 

A growing European telecoms company was in a consolidating sector. It was eventually acquired by a global operator.

The Sub-Fund does not invest in stocks or sectors that do not fit within the above three categories; in particular those assets that the team cannot value confidently, such as banks, insurers, miners and energy companies.

investment philosophy.

 

At Lombard Odier Investment Managers, we believe sustainability has the potential to drive future returns7

 

1

Financial models 
We look for attractively-priced companies that can deliver sustainable growth, which we consider to have a transparent and solid business model and have a competitive advantage over their peers.

2 Tiered portfolio construction
We believe high quality companies tend to outperform in down markets; high growth companies can benefit in rising markets; and corporate event candidates tend to profit in M&A-fuelled environments. By allocating to all three buckets, we aim to diversify the risk
3 Risk management
We believe high performance starts with stringent risk management. The team continuously monitors 12 trading and fundamental risk metrics, which also serve to maintain investment discipline. An independent risk management team monitors the portfolio alongside the investment team.

The end result 

The result is a core European portfolio that aims to outperform over the medium to long term. The team equally weights portfolio holdings, where possible, to provide sufficient diversification without diluting potential returns.

 

By taking a long-term view, we avoid betting heavily on market direction and focus instead on sustainable businesses that we believe can unlock value over time.
